This last weekend I ran a tournament with a bunch of friends. Below are the four games that I played (including the championship). The final standings are also below. We used the BAO scoring and missions (much thanks to Frontline Gaming).
Round #1
Tau Empire vs Orks
Round #2
Tau Empire vs CSM
Round #3
Tau Empire vs Space Wolves
Round #4 (Championship Game)
Tau Empire vs Necrons
Round 4 Standings (Final)
4-0-0 4034 Tau Empire
3-1-0 3020 Chaos Space Marines
3-1-0 3013 Necrons
2-2-0 2017 Tau Empire
1-1-2 2004 Space Wolves
1-2-1 2001 Tau Empire
1-2-1 1511 Space Wolves
1-3-0 1006 Tyranids
1-3-0 1005 Orks
0-0-4 3 Space Marines
